Benefits of a Layered Blunt Cut for Fine Hair
There are many benefits to getting a layered blunt cut for fine hair. Here are just a few:
- It creates the illusion of more volume. The layers in a blunt cut help to add depth and dimension to your hair, which can make it look thicker and fuller.
- It's easy to style. A layered blunt cut is very versatile, and it can be styled in a variety of ways. You can wear it straight, wavy, or curly, and it will always look polished and put-together.
- It's low-maintenance. A layered blunt cut requires very little styling, which is perfect for busy women. You can simply blow it dry or air-dry it, and it will look great.
Tips for Styling a Layered Blunt Cut for Fine Hair
Here are a few tips for styling a layered blunt cut for fine hair:
- Use volumizing products. Volumizing shampoo, conditioner, and styling products can help to add fullness to your hair.
- Use a round brush. A round brush will help to create lift and volume at the roots.
- Blow dry your hair upside down. Blow drying your hair upside down will help to create more volume.
- Use a texturizing spray. A texturizing spray will help to add texture and definition to your hair.

FAQ of layered blunt cut for fine hair
Q: Is a layered blunt cut good for fine hair?
A: A layered blunt cut can be a great option for fine hair, as it can add volume and fullness without weighing the hair down. However, it is important to get the layers right, as too many layers can actually make the hair look thinner. The best way to find out if a layered blunt cut is right for you is to consult with a hairstylist who specializes in fine hair.
Q: What are the benefits of a layered blunt cut for fine hair?
A: There are several benefits to a layered blunt cut for fine hair, including:
- Volume: The layers can help to add volume and fullness to the hair, making it look thicker and more voluminous.
- Body: The layers can also help to add body to the hair, making it easier to style and manage.
- Movement: The layers can also help to create movement in the hair, making it look more lively and dynamic.
- Style versatility: A layered blunt cut is a versatile style that can be styled in a variety of ways, from sleek and polished to edgy and undone.
Q: What are the drawbacks of a layered blunt cut for fine hair?
A: There are a few potential drawbacks to a layered blunt cut for fine hair, including:
- Maintenance: The layers can require more maintenance than a blunt cut, as they will need to be trimmed more often to keep them looking their best.
- Styling: The layers can also be more difficult to style than a blunt cut, as they can be more prone to flyaways and frizz.
Q: How do I style a layered blunt cut for fine hair?
A: There are a few different ways to style a layered blunt cut for fine hair, including:
- Blow-drying with a round brush: This will help to create volume and body in the hair.
- Using texturizing products: This will help to add texture and definition to the hair.
- Pin-curling the layers: This will help to create soft waves or curls in the hair.
- Using a diffuser attachment on your hair dryer: This will help to dry the hair without frizzing it.
Q: What are some tips for choosing a layered blunt cut for fine hair?
A: Here are a few tips for choosing a layered blunt cut for fine hair:
- Consider your hair texture: If your hair is fine and straight, you will want to choose a layered blunt cut that is not too short.
- Consider your face shape: If you have a round face, you will want to choose a layered blunt cut that has longer layers around the face to help elongate your face.
- Consider your lifestyle: If you have a busy lifestyle, you will want to choose a layered blunt cut that is low-maintenance.
